Symbols mean whatever the people who use them agree that they mean. The origin of the modern peace sign supposedly combined the semaphore symbols for ND, meaning Nuclear Disarmament.

I doubt Craigslist has anything to do with being covertly anti-Christian. They just want to make loads of money while congratulating themselves on how cool they are. I have to admit they have tried to rein in the prostitution and other explicitly illegal activity. They never will—the underground stuff just changes jargon to stay one step ahead of the monitors.
